The District of Kitimat is recruiting for a Director of Planning. Reporting to the Chief Administrative Officer, the Director will oversee the planning department of three planners and one planning administrative assistant and play an integral role on the District’s senior management team.
Where is the job?
Located in Northwest BC, Kitimat is a master-planned greenbelt community and home to just over 8,000 residents. Kitimat provides a stable tax base and is experiencing growth from increased levels of industrial, residential, and commercial development. What will you do?
- Provide technical and professional advice on land use and planning related matters to Council, the Chief Administrative Officer and other Municipal Departments, Council Committees and Commissions, developers, industrial project proponents and the public.
- Prepare, recommend and implement both short- and long- term planning strategies and plans.
- Recommend administrative and Council action regarding development applications for such matters as zoning amendment, temporary land use, and development permits; and ensure application processing occurs in accordance with provincial statutes and the Kitimat Municipal Code.
- Provide leadership and daily supervision to municipal employees and provide direction on workflow and priorities to staff.

What do you bring with you?
- A university degree, preferably a post graduate degree in planning or a closely related field
- Relevant work experience including supervisory experience in a municipal setting
- Knowledge of local government practices in community planning
- A proven ability to manage complex planning projects
- Current membership or membership eligibility with the Planning Institute of British Columbia
